½ Franc
Country: Switzerland
Denomination: 1/2 Franc / Franken / Franco
(0.5 CHF)
Year: 1875-1967
Material: Silver (.835)
Weight: 2.5 g
Shape: Round
Diameter: 18.2 mm
Type: Common coin
Catalog list: switzerland
Description:
Obverse
Helvetia, the female personification of Switzerland, wearing a toga, is holding a spear and is leaning on a Swiss shield. She is encircled by the 22 stars representing the 22 cantons in which the Confederation then consisted.
